\example itemviews/spinboxdelegate+ −
\title Spin Box Delegate Example+ −
+ −
The Spin Box Delegate example shows how to create an editor for a custom delegate in+ −
the model/view framework by reusing a standard Qt editor widget.+ −
+ −
The model/view framework provides a standard delegate that is used by default+ −
with the standard view classes. For most purposes, the selection of editor+ −
widgets available through this delegate is sufficient for editing text, boolean+ −
values, and other simple data types. However, for specific data types, it is+ −
sometimes necessary to use a custom delegate to either display the data in a+ −
specific way, or allow the user to edit it with a custom control.+ −

\section1 SpinBoxDelegate Class Definition+ −
+ −
The definition of the delegate is as follows:+ −
+ −
\snippet examples/itemviews/spinboxdelegate/delegate.h 0+ −
+ −
The delegate class declares only those functions that are needed to+ −
create an editor widget, display it at the correct location in a view,+ −
and communicate with a model. Custom delegates can also provide their+ −
own painting code by reimplementing the \c paintEvent() function.+ −
+ −
\section1 SpinBoxDelegate Class Implementation+ −
+ −
Since the delegate is stateless, the constructor only needs to+ −
call the base class's constructor with the parent QObject as its+ −
argument:+ −
+ −
\snippet examples/itemviews/spinboxdelegate/delegate.cpp 0+ −
+ −
Since the delegate is a subclass of QItemDelegate, the data it retrieves+ −
from the model is displayed in a default style, and we do not need to+ −
provide a custom \c paintEvent().+ −
+ −
The \c createEditor() function returns an editor widget, in this case a+ −
spin box that restricts values from the model to integers from 0 to 100+ −
inclusive.+ −
+ −
\snippet examples/itemviews/spinboxdelegate/delegate.cpp 1+ −
+ −
We install an event filter on the spin box to ensure that it behaves in+ −
a way that is consistent with other delegates. The implementation for+ −
the event filter is provided by the base class.+ −
+ −
The \c setEditorData() function reads data from the model, converts it+ −
to an integer value, and writes it to the editor widget.+ −
+ −
\snippet examples/itemviews/spinboxdelegate/delegate.cpp 2+ −
+ −
Since the view treats delegates as ordinary QWidget instances, we have+ −
to use a static cast before we can set the value in the spin box.+ −
+ −
The \c setModelData() function reads the contents of the spin box, and+ −
writes it to the model.+ −
+ −
\snippet examples/itemviews/spinboxdelegate/delegate.cpp 3+ −
+ −
We call \l{QSpinBox::interpretText()}{interpretText()} to make sure that+ −
we obtain the most up-to-date value in the spin box.+ −
+ −
The \c updateEditorGeometry() function updates the editor widget's+ −
geometry using the information supplied in the style option. This is the+ −
minimum that the delegate must do in this case.+ −
+ −
\snippet examples/itemviews/spinboxdelegate/delegate.cpp 4+ −
+ −
More complex editor widgets may divide the rectangle available in+ −
\c{option.rect} between different child widgets if required.+ −

\section1 The Main Function+ −
+ −
This example is written in a slightly different way to many of the+ −
other examples supplied with Qt. To demonstrate the use of a custom+ −
editor widget in a standard view, it is necessary to set up a model+ −
containing some arbitrary data and a view to display it.+ −
+ −
We set up the application in the normal way, construct a standard item+ −
model to hold some data, set up a table view to use the data in the+ −
model, and construct a custom delegate to use for editing:+ −
+ −
\snippet examples/itemviews/spinboxdelegate/main.cpp 0+ −
+ −
The table view is informed about the delegate, and will use it to+ −
display each of the items. Since the delegate is a subclass of+ −
QItemDelegate, each cell in the table will be rendered using standard+ −
painting operations.+ −
+ −
We insert some arbitrary data into the model for demonstration purposes:+ −
+ −
\snippet examples/itemviews/spinboxdelegate/main.cpp 1+ −
\snippet examples/itemviews/spinboxdelegate/main.cpp 2+ −
+ −
Finally, the table view is displayed with a window title, and we start+ −
the application's event loop:+ −
+ −
\snippet examples/itemviews/spinboxdelegate/main.cpp 3+ −
+ −
Each of the cells in the table can now be edited in the usual way, but+ −
the spin box ensures that the data returned to the model is always+ −
constrained by the values allowed by the spin box delegate.+ −
